Example of operation
Initial situation
You would like to switch from the vehicle
function to the radio function and select a
station from the station list, for example.
The following operating example describes
how to:
• call up the audio function
• switch on radio mode
• set a station.
Calling up the audio function
Select Audio in the main function bar by
sliding and turning
the COMAND
controller and press to confirm.
The basic display of the current audio
operating mode, e.g. audio CD, appears.
Switching to radio mode
Option 1
Press the function button. The radio display appears.
Repeated pressing of this function button switches between radio and the most recently active audio source.
Option 2
Select Audio again by sliding
the
COMAND controller and press to
confirm.
The Audio menu appears.
1 Current audio operating mode
2 Main function bar
3 Audio menu
Press the COMAND controller
and
confirm Radio.
The radio basic display appears with the
waveband last selected.
To set the station: if the display/selection window is activated in the radio display, turn or slide COMAND controller.
